Some of the most lightweight scooters on the market include the Di Blasi R30, which can be fully folded with the press of the button. The scooter can be easily lifted in and out from the boot of an automobile. It can be pulled like a suitcase, and is ideal for public transport.
Another option is the MWay Superlite Auto Folding Scooter, which can be split into two pieces to make it easier for lifting. best folding mobility scooter -ion battery it uses is airline and cruise ship-approved, making it a great travel companion. It's also extremely robust and comes with a variety of accessories, such as a spacious basket and an adjustable armrest.
Routine maintenance is crucial to keep your lightweight mobility device in tip-top condition. For example, you should check the brakes and tyres for cracks and cuts regularly. Replace the batteries as needed. This will extend the life of your scooter.

When choosing a mobility scooter, you should take into consideration how much weight it can be able to support and the length it can be on a single charge. You should also make sure the battery is easy to replace and maintain, and that the mobility scooter is compatible with your home's power source.
Another thing to think about is the size of the mobility scooter, and whether it will be capable of fitting through the door of your front. It is important to choose an easy-to-use and compact mobility scooter if you have smaller space. It is possible to move it around without the need to lift it over a fence, or through a doorway that is small.

If you plan on travelling with your scooter, it is crucial to select a model that is able to be dismantled to travel by air. Choose models with easy-to-use controls, and a removable lithium-ion battery. You may also want to consider one with a greater turning radius to ensure greater stability on uneven surfaces. Also, consider the distance you can travel on a single charge.
Make sure that the mobility scooter you choose can accommodate your weight and height. Make sure that the seat, handlebars and the tiller are at a level that is comfortable for you. Also, consider the width of the handles and whether they are appropriate for your hands. You must also consider the space you have to store your scooter.
